Manganese accumulation in red blood cells as a biomarker of manganese exposure and neurotoxicity
Neurotoxicology. 2024 Mar 10;102:1-11. doi: 10.1016/j.neuro.2024.03.003. Online ahead of print.ABSTRACTAlthough overexposure to manganese (Mn) is known to cause neurotoxic damage, effective exposure markers for assessing Mn loading in Mn-exposed workers are lacking. Here, we construct a Mn-exposed rat model to perform correlation analysis between Mn-induced neurological damage and Mn levels in various biological samples. We combine this analysis with epidemiological investigation to assess whether Mn concentrations in red blood cells (MnRBCs) and urine (MnU) can be used as valid exposure markers. A manganese-based catalyst system for general oxidation of unactivated olefins, alkanes, and alcohols
This article is licensed under aCreative Commons Attribution 3.0 Unported Licence.Dennis Verspeek, Sebastian Ahrens, Xiandong Wen, Yong Yang, Yong-Wang Li, Kathrin Junge, Matthias Beller An inexpensive MnCl2–picolinic acid catalyst with N-heterocyclic additives enables epoxidation of unactivated olefins, selective C–H oxidation of simple alkanes to ketones, and O–H oxidation of alcohols with hydrogen peroxide at ambient conditions. Heavy Metals in Common Fishes Consumed in Dhaka, a Megacity of Asia: A Probabilistic Carcinogenic and Non-Carcinogenic Health Hazard
In this study, six commonly consumed fish species namely Hilsha (Tenualosa ilisha), Kachki (Corica soborna), Punti (Puntitus ticto), Taki (Channa punctatus), Meni (Nandus nandus), and Tengra (Mystus tengara) were analyzed for arsenic (As), cadmium (Cd), lead (Pb), zinc (Zn), copper (Cu), chromium (Cr), manganese (Mn), and nickel (Ni), by inductively coupled plasma mass spectrometry. The fish samples were collected from wholesale markets in Dhaka city, the main business hub of Bangladesh where the fishes converged from countrywide and are redistributed to the whole city. Unlocking Double Redox Reaction of Metal-Organic Framework for Aqueous Zinc-Ion Battery
Angew Chem Int Ed Engl. 2024 Mar 6:e202401996. doi: 10.1002/anie.202401996. Online ahead of print.ABSTRACTMetal-organic frameworks (MOFs) show wide application as the cathode of aqueous zinc-ion batteries (AZIBs) in the future owning to their high porosity, diverse structures, abundant species, and controllable morphology. However, the low energy density and poor cycling stability hinder the feasibility in practical application. Peroxymonosulfate activation by cobalt –manganese layered double hydroxide for bisphenol A degradation
CrystEngComm, 2024, Advance Article DOI: 10.1039/D4CE00015C, PaperMengmeng Jin, Bing Xu, Jiao Zhang, Zhaopan Wang, Baolin Xing, Guiyun Yi, Lunjian Chen, Yuanfeng Wu, Zhenhua Li In this paper, CoMn-layered double hydroxide (CoMn-LDH) was synthesized by the co-precipitation method, and it was applied to activate peroxymonosulfate (PMS) for degradation of bisphenol A (BPA).
